Is a thinner yoga mat better?

There are a few things to consider when choosing a yoga mat. The first is thickness. A thicker mat can provide more cushioning, but it might also be more difficult to move around on. A thinner mat might be better if you’re looking for more flexibility.

The second thing to consider is material. Yoga mats can be made from a variety of materials, such as PVC, rubber, or foam. PVC and rubber mats are usually the most durable, while foam mats can be less durable and might not be suitable for hot yoga classes.

Finally, consider the size of the mat. The standard size is about 68 inches long and 24 inches wide, but you might want a smaller or larger mat depending on your body size and yoga style.

So, is a thinner yoga mat better? It depends on your preferences and needs. If you’re looking for more flexibility and a lighter mat, then a thinner yoga mat might be a good choice. However, if you’re looking for more cushioning and durability, then a thicker mat might be a better option.

Is a 4mm or 6mm yoga mat better?

When it comes to yoga mats, there are a few things to consider: size, thickness, and material.

The size of the mat is important because you need enough space to move around without hitting your feet on the ground. The standard size is 68 inches by 24 inches, but if you’re tall or have a large practice space, you may prefer a longer or wider mat.

The thickness of the mat is also important. A thin mat may be more challenging to balance on and can be slippery, while a thicker mat can provide more cushioning. Most mats range in thickness from 3mm to 6mm.

The material of the mat is also important. Some materials, like PVC, can be toxic, while others, like natural rubber or jute, are environmentally friendly. Some materials are also more durable than others.
